What is weekend cold calling?

Weekend cold calling jobs involve reaching out to potential clients, customers, or leads by phone during the weekends, typically to promote products, services, or gather information. Employees in these roles follow a script or guidelines and often work from a call center or remotely. The goal is to generate interest, set appointments, or collect data, and these positions may require good communication and persuasion skills. Weekend hours are targeted to reach people who may not be available during the traditional workweek.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end cold caller?

To excel as a Weekend Cold Caller, you typically need strong verbal communication skills, a persuasive attitude, and prior experience or training in sales or telemarketing.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software and autodialing systems is often required. Resilience, persistence, and active listening are important soft skills that help build rapport and handle rejection effectively. These abilities are crucial for achieving sales targets, maintaining productivity, and creating positive customer interactions during high-volume calling periods.

What are some typical challenges faced in a weekend cold calling role, and how can I overcome them?

Weekend Cold Calling professionals often encounter challenges such as reaching decision-makers outside standard business hours and handling a higher rate of unanswered calls. To overcome these, it's helpful to prepare engaging voicemail scripts, track optimal calling times for better response rates, and maintain a resilient, positive attitude. Regular feedback sessions with your team or supervisor can also help refine your approach and improve results over time.

Job description

Full time  M-F from 8 AM-4 PM


The Repossession Field Agent's job involves communicating with internal staff, external team members and consumer’s delinquent on a payment agreement.  You will be investigating and tracking the known locations of cars out for repossession, securing them, and towing the vehicles to the closest company storage facility.  Once towed, you will be responsible for appropriate, timely and accurate documentation.  No Cold Calling-ALL accounts provided by established business.
